    I went bowfishing in some flood waters from th Mississippi tonight. I drove past this spot that got cut off from the river after it went down. I could see carp swimmimg around in the shallows, so I figured I had to try it. It was probably about 5-6 acres in size. I got a couple wading out in it and most of them as they swam across a shallow spot that was a field road. I nailed 7 in all. The biggest weighed 7.6 pounds.
